Start with the geography your intake actually serves
Estherville and Emmet County are not interchangeable with all of Iowa. If your firm serves Estherville residents, nearby communities, countywide clients or a broader Iowa market, those service boundaries should be explicit in the intake flow. The city’s 5,839-person 2020–2024 ACS estimate is context for the municipality only. It should not be turned into a forecast of inquiries, cases or revenue. Instead, use your own records to identify where inquiries originate and which geographic distinctions affect eligibility, conflicts, urgency or routing.
